Both CPUs are manufactured by AMD.
AMD FX-4320 has a higher base speed of 4.0 GHz compared to AMD A12-9800's 3.8 GHz.
Both CPUs have the same turbo speed of 4.2 GHz.
Both CPUs have the same number of cores (4).
Both CPUs support the same number of threads ().
Both CPUs belong to the same class: Desktop.
AMD A12-9800 uses the AM4 socket, while AMD FX-4320 uses the AM3+ socket.
AMD A12-9800 was launched in Q4 2016, while AMD FX-4320 was launched in Q1 2016.
AMD FX-4320 has a larger L3 cache of 4 MB compared to AMD A12-9800's MB.
